NATO assigns additional headquarters to Baltic region as U.S. general pledges support.

U.S. General Chris Donahue stated that the United States will stand with European allies in defending the Baltic countries. NATO assigned an additional headquarters to the region, with multinational divisions in Estonia and Latvia now coming under the command of the German Netherlands Corps.
